		<description><![CDATA[Today is 16-Oct-1939, the 46th day of World War II; there are 2,147 days left in the conflict.
Germany&#8217;s Oberkommando der Wehrmacht (OKW &#8211; High Command of the Wehrmacht/Armed Forces) issues a communique that the Polish Campaign is officially ended, although a few regular Polish troops continue to offer token resistance in remote areas. This part [...]]]></description>
